DIY gifts can not only be super cost effective but they show your loved one that you took the time and effort to make them something special. You’re showing them your appreciation by giving them something that was made for them and only them. With Valentine’s Day right around the corner, here’s some inspiration to help you do something a little extra special for that special person in your life.

1. A candy box

For around $5, you can pick up a plastic container at your local craft store or even order one off of Amazon. Some even come with adjustable compartments to fill with all your significant others favorite candy and treats. You can tape a cute piece of tissue paper on the inside of the box or write a cute little message on the outside to make it more festive.

2. A message jar

Take a mason jar or other glass jar of your choosing and fill it with a bunch of different notes that have compliments, favorite memories, inside jokes, things that remind you of them, etc. A message jar is a simple gift that’s guaranteed to make your significant other smile, not just on Valentine’s Day, but all year long.

3. Deck of love

This is a cute gift idea for anyone. You take a deck of cards and fill them with 52 reasons why you love that person. The reasons could be heartfelt, silly, or even as simple as “I love you because you’re you.” Everyone likes to feel appreciated and this is a great way to do just that.

4. Carved candle

A carved candle is another simple gift for just about anyone. Start with a candle of that person’s favorite scent and simply carve your little message right into the side. Trace over your message with a marker and add some decorative stickers to make it really pop. Wrap a bow around the top using some festive ribbon and it’s as simple as that.
